<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>What&#8217;s the difference between a wedding planner and a coordinator?</strong></h2>



<p>A wedding planner and a wedding coordinator play very different roles, and understanding the difference can really help when deciding what support you need.</p>



<p>A wedding planner is involved from the very beginning, guiding you through the entire planning journey. They help shape your vision, manage your budget, source and liaise with your suppliers, and support you with decisions along the way.</p>



<p>A wedding coordinator steps in much closer to the wedding day, usually around one month beforehand. Their focus is on taking everything you’ve planned and making sure it runs exactly as it should. They manage the timings, liaise with and greet suppliers, oversee the day&#8217;s logistics, and handle anything that pops up on the day, so you’re not answering questions or problem-solving while you should be enjoying every moment.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">How much does a wedding coordinator cost?</h2>



<p>Having a wedding coordinator is an investment in how your day feels. When couples look back on their wedding, they rarely remember every tiny detail. They remember how they felt, calm, happy, excited, and fully present. A wedding coordinator protects that feeling.</p>



<p>We take care of the logistics so you can focus on the moments that matter, the hugs, the laughs, the happy tears, and the celebration. That’s why so many couples say it was the best investment they made.</p>



<p>For most weddings with us, on the day coordination usually sits between £1,750 and £2,500. In the context of an overall wedding budget, it’s a relatively small part, but the impact is felt throughout the entire day. It’s not just about someone running the schedule, it’s about having the space to enjoy your wedding without worrying about what’s happening next.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Kew Gardens&nbsp;</strong></h2>



<p>Kew Gardens offers stunning glasshouse settings for weddings, from the Temperate House to the Nash Conservatory that can accommodate up to 200 guests. Kew delivers year-round botanical beauty &#8211; ideal for couples after a unique visitor attraction wedding in the UK plus your mode of transport can include a golf buggy to whip you around the grounds for photos &#8211; how cool! Notably, Fearne Cotton and Jesse Wood held their wedding reception at the Orangery.&nbsp;</p>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Warwick Castle</strong></h3>



<p>Warwick Castle is a fairytale setting offering licensed rooms for ceremonies from 20 to around 180 guests. Options range from medieval-style chambers to outdoor marquees on castle lawns. Packages often include access to towers for photography and evening entertainment. With nearly 1,000 years of ultimate history, it’s one of the UK’s most iconic visitor-attraction wedding venues.&nbsp;</p>

<h6 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Natural History Museum&nbsp;</strong></h6>



<p>Arguably one of the most famous museums in the world the Natural History Museum offers 12 licensed spaces for weddings, with ceremony/dinner capacities ranging from 100 to over 200 guests. Home to Hintze Hall where you can get married underneath the iconic blue whale! What a wow factor, hey?! Along with gallery receptions with dramatic architecture and exhibits. Built in 1881, it’s a landmark visitor attraction wedding venue for couples wanting grandeur and unforgettable photo opportunities.</p>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Eden Project&nbsp;</strong></h3>



<p>The Eden Project offers weddings in their famous biomes. Licensed for ceremonies and receptions, capacities range from 160 to 500 guests depending on space. Couples can marry in the Rainforest or Mediterranean Biome with stunning dramatic, tropical visuals. It’s one of Cornwall’s top visitor attraction wedding venues — perfect for nature lovers or couples after something unconventional.&nbsp;This was a bucket list wedding venue for us to work at and we can&#8217;t wait for the next wedding we plan here!</p>

<h4 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Hampton Court Palace</strong></h4>



<p>Hampton Court Palace offers historic wedding settings like the Great Hall, Garden Room and Little Banqueting House. Licensed for civil ceremonies, the palace can host up to 200 guests for ceremonies and 220 for receptions. The Great Hall, which is Henry VIII’s former feasting chamber (!), provides dramatic photo backdrops. In September 2014, Opera singer Katherine Jenkins and American film director Andrew tied the knot at Hampton Court Palace. With Tudor and Baroque architecture, it&#8217;s one of the great visitor attraction wedding venues in the UK.</p>

<h6 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Tower Bridge&nbsp;</strong></h6>



<p>Tower Bridge, arguably one of the most well known attractions in London, offers licensed ceremony spaces in the North Tower Lounge (35–60 guests) and dramatic receptions on the High-Level Walkways (up to 120+ guests). With panoramic, iconic views of the Thames and exclusive evening access, it one of the most picturesque spots in London! For a visitor attraction wedding UK experience with unmistakable London flair, Tower Bridge is a perfect setting for a London wedding!</p>

<h4 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Ardross Castle&nbsp;</strong></h4>



<p>Ardross Castle in the Scottish Highlands, now famous as The Traitors filming location, is available for exclusive-use weddings. With dramatic interiors, estate grounds and marquee options, it’s surged in popularity. The Great Hall within the castle holds up to 130 guests for a wedding breakfast. The castle comes as is, and is hired on a dry hire basis, so you can bring your own caterer and all of your own suppliers &#8211; massive pro! You even get accommodation for up to 41 of your guests to pretend they are traitors! TV fame has made this a trending visitor-attraction wedding venue, ideal for fans of the show or those seeking a hidden gem in the Highlands. Availability is limited due to high demand, we are seeing couples book at least 2-3 years ahead for weddings at this venue!</p>

<h5 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Gretna Green&nbsp;</strong></h5>



<p>Gretna Green remains the UK’s most famous elopement destination, offering iconic “anvil weddings” at the Famous Blacksmiths’ Shop and venues like Gretna Hall. From small, intimate ceremonies to larger celebrations, their wedding packages let you create a day that’s completely unique to your love story. You’ll also find delicious, fully bespoke wedding breakfasts to make the occasion even more special for up to 150 guests in the Famous Blacksmiths shop. The runaway wedding history and unique ceremony style make it popular with couples after a romantic and memorable visitor attraction wedding in Scotland &#8211; with a twist of tradition.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Why Do We Have Wedding Cakes Anyway?</strong></h2>



<p>Wedding cakes have been a thing for a very long time. Back to Ancient Rome, instead of cutting a cake, they’d break a loaf of barley bread over the bride’s head for luck. Romantic, right? Nothing says true love like a carb-based concussion.</p>



<p>Then in Medieval times, people would stack pastries into a tower, very me, and if the couple could kiss over it without knocking it down, it was said to bring good fortune! A high-stakes pastry Jenga, you could say! </p>



<p>Fast forward to royalty and the upper classes, who went all in on tiered, sugar-loaded, flamboyant cakes displaying a sign of wealth and fortune. And now? We still love a good tradition, and cake is definitely one of them! Whether it’s fancy,  low key or gluten-free, you’re pretty much guaranteed cake at a wedding.</p>

<h6 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Making the Cake the Main Dessert</strong></h6>



<p>A really smart trend we’re seeing is using the wedding cake as the main dessert. It makes so much sense, both logistically and financially.</p>



<p>By serving the cake as dessert, you can cut it at the start of the meal while all your guests are seated and paying attention. It also means you can skip the cost of a separate dessert course altogether.</p>



<p>Guests are much more likely to eat the cake when it’s served as part of the meal, and you can elevate it with beautiful plating. Add some berries, a drizzle of coulis or a fancy sweet sauce, and you’ve got something that feels special.</p>



<p>Plus, it puts the cake in the spotlight it deserves, not just wheeled out during the awkward post-speech lull.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">HOW ARE WEDDING RINGS WORN?</h2>



<p>Traditionally, Wedding rings are worn on the fourth finger of the left hand, the “ring finger”. Sometimes this varies across cultures and personal preferences for example, in Orthodox Christian traditions, wedding rings are worn on the right hand instead. </p>



<p>Most people wear their engagement and wedding rings together on the same finger, with the wedding band closer to the heart, below the engagement ring. But some prefer to wear them on separate hands, totally up to personal style!</p>



<p>For people who can’t wear rings at work, like doctors or construction workers, or people who just prefer not to, wearing the ring on a chain around their neck is a popular alternative. Recently, we’ve also seen a rise in ring “alternatives” like silicone bands, which are great for active lifestyles, and travel-friendly “fake” rings for those who don’t want to risk losing the real deal on holidays, or even opting for no ring at all and going for a tattoo on the ring finger. It’s all about what works best for you!</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">WHY DO WE WEAR WEDDING RINGS ON THE LEFT HAND?</h2>



<p>The tradition of wearing a wedding ring on the left hand goes way back, thousands of years, and is tied to both history and symbolism. There’s the “Vein of Love” theory, from ancient Rome where the Romans believed the vein called the Vena Amoris ran directly from the fourth finger on the left hand directly to the heart. It was seen as a romantic and symbolic way to connect the ring directly to love itself. Modern anatomy has proven that all fingers have veins leading directly to the heart, but tradition has stood the test of time!</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">CHOOSING THE PERFECT WEDDING RING</h2>



<p>Picking the perfect wedding ring is a big deal! It’s something you’ll (hopefully) wear every day, so it should feel perfect!</p>



<p>The first thing to think about is the material. A classic yellow gold, sleek white gold, modern platinum, or maybe something a little different like rose gold or titanium. Each metal has its own look, feel, and durability, so it’s important to consider things like your lifestyle. If you’re hard on jewellery, platinum is super durable, while gold is softer. If you have metal allergies, hypoallergenic options like platinum or titanium might be a better option. </p>



<p>Jewellers will usually suggest getting matching metals for your wedding and engagement ring, not just for visuals but because different metals wear down at different rates, so if you stack a softer gold band with a harder platinum one, the gold could wear down faster over time. At the end of the day, it’s about choosing rings that feel right for each of you.</p>

<p>Next, when thinking about your rings, you need to consider style and comfort. Some people love a simple, timeless band, while others want something with diamonds or unique detailing. If you’re wearing it with an engagement ring, make sure they look good together! Some bands are designed to fit snugly against certain engagement ring styles. Comfort is also important as you’ll be wearing it daily. It’s good to try different widths and finishes to see what feels best on your finger. Also, think about ring profiles, curved, flat, domed, they all feel a little different when worn, especially when stacked next to an engagement ring, or future eternity band… </p>



<p>Some other things to think about are practicality and personal touches. If you’re an active person or work with your hands a lot, a low-maintenance ring like a brushed finish or a plain band might be better than something with intricate designs or stones that need regular cleaning. Men will often choose Titanium as it’s lightweight, durable, low maintenance and hypoallergenic or Platinum which is also a great choice for a wedding band as it’s incredibly durable, naturally hypoallergenic, and has a timeless, elegant look. It’s also resistant to tarnish and corrosion, so it keeps its look for years without needing constant upkeep.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ading"><strong>Not Loved This Year</strong></h2>



<p><strong>Champagne Towers</strong> Yes, they look stunning in photos, but champagne towers are more hassle than they’re worth. They’re fiddly to set up, prone to mishaps, and often feel more style than substance. Let’s toast to seeing fewer of these in 2025. If you really need champagne in your wedding photos, let’s go back to a good ole champagne spray!</p>



<p><strong>Completely Open Bars</strong> Offering every drink under the sun can be a logistical nightmare and unnecessarily costly. Not to mention the state of the guests at the end of the night!  I’ve seen couples opt for a pared-back bar with just a couple of signature cocktails, beer, and wine—and it works so much better. Thoughtful and streamlined is the way forward.</p>
